The Home Office is introducing a new UK passport design starting December 1. The most notable change is the replacement of Queen Elizabeth II’s Coat of Arms with King Charles III’s on the front cover. Inside, the geometric pattern is replaced with images of UNESCO-protected landscapes from the four nations of the UK. The new passports also feature advanced holographic and translucent security features, making them the most secure yet.
